After you finish with all of your settings, click "Apply" and the following message will
be displayed on your web browser:
Press "Go Back" to save the settings and go back to the web management interface; press
"Apply" to save the settings made and restart the Smart Repeater Pro. The settings will
take effect after it reboots.
You can delete selected rules by clicking this
button. You can select one or more rules to delete by check the
"select" the box of the rule(s) you want to delete a time. If the
QoS table is empty, this button will be grayed out and cannot
be clicked.
By clicking this button, you can delete all rules currently in the
QoS table. If the QoS table is empty, this button will be grayed
out and cannot be clicked.
You can pull up the priority of the QoS rule you selected by
clicking this button.
You can lower the priority of the QoS rule you selected by
clicking this button.
